Top 5 Best 32817 Florida Public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 6 public schools serving 5,389 students in 32817, FL (there are 3 private schools, serving 401 private students). 93% of all K-12 students in 32817, FL are educated in public schools (compared to the FL state average of 86%).
The top ranked public schools in 32817, FL are Arbor Ridge K-8, Riverdale Elementary School and University High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 32817 have an average math proficiency score of 45% (versus the Florida public school average of 53%), and reading proficiency score of 46% (versus the 52% statewide average). Schools in 32817, FL have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Florida public schools.
Minority enrollment is 81%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Florida public school average of 66% (majority Hispanic).
